Marussia still mulling options
Marussia Sporting Director Graeme Lowdon has said that fielding two drivers with Formula 1 race experience would make sense for the team next season - but admits there are "still possibilities that we need to explore".The Banbury-based outfit have one seat still open for 2014 following confirmation that Ferrari protege Jules Bianchi would be retained for a second season.
Several drivers are believed to be in the running for the other drive, including incumbent Max Chilton and McLaren's young talent Kevin Magnussen, as confirmed by Lowdon himself earlier this month.
